2 definitions found
From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
auto-da-fe
,
Au·to-da-fé
n.
;
pl
.
Autos-da-fé
1.
A
judgment
of
the
Inquisition
in
Spain
and
Portugal
condemning
or
acquitting
persons
accused
of
religious
offenses
.
2.
An
execution
of
such
sentence
,
by
the
civil
power
,
esp
.
the
burning
of
a
heretic
.
It
was
usually
held
on
Sunday
,
and
was
made
a
great
public
solemnity
by
impressive
forms
and
ceremonies
.
4.
A
session
of
the
court
of
Inquisition
.

From:
WordNet (r) 2.0
auto-da-fe
n
:
the
burning
to
death
of
heretics
(
as
during
the
Spanish
Inquisition
)
[
also
:
autos-da-fe
(
pl
)]
